Korn v. SOUTHFIELD CITY CLERK
Citations: 692 N.W.2d 839; 472 Mich. 867Docket: 126818
Court: Michigan Supreme Court; February 27, 2005; Michigan; State Supreme Court
The Supreme Court of Michigan denied the application for leave to appeal the Court of Appeals' judgment dated July 27, 2004, in the case of Korn v. Southfield City Clerk (No. 126818). The Court concluded that the issues raised did not warrant review, rendering the application for leave to appeal as cross-appellant moot and also denied.
